A law firm seeks a Senior Litigation Associate Attorney in Grand Rapids, MI.

Job Overview: The Senior Litigation Associate Attorney will interpret laws, rulings, and regulations for clients involved in litigation, manage client relationships, conduct legal research, draft legal documents, and assist with all aspects of discovery. The ideal candidate will demonstrate superior legal skills, a strong work ethic, and the ability to work independently and collaboratively within a team environment.

Job Duties:

  • Interpret laws, rulings, and regulations for individuals and businesses involved in litigation.
  • Cultivate and generate new client relationships.
  • Manage new and existing client relationships.
  • Conducted legal research and drafted memos for partners.
  • Draft pleadings, motions, and briefs.
  • Attend legal proceedings, including motion hearings, evidentiary hearings, mediations, and depositions.
  • Assist with all areas of discovery, including drafting requests and responses, preparing initial disclosures, and witness preparation.
  • Work with partner-level attorneys to determine document production strategies and vendor selection.
  • Organize, review, and maintain case documents; supervise or coordinate coding and database development.
  • Review documents for responsiveness to discovery requests.
  • Monitor completeness of discovery responses.
  • Review and assemble deposition, trial, and motion exhibits.
  • Index and summarize deposition testimony and exhibits.
  • Gather impeaching materials for adverse experts.
  • Prepare trial materials.
  • Attend and assist at pretrial, trial, and post-trial proceedings.

Requirements:

  • Superior intellect and ability to grasp complex legal issues.
  • Strong work ethic and willingness to work as needed.
  • Good organizational and project management skills.
  • Proficiency in online legal research services and resources.
  • Superior legal writing and oral communication skills.
  • Sound judgment and ability to work independently.
  • Expertise in litigation concepts, practices, and procedures.
  • Ability to work collaboratively and adapt to changing environments.
  • Experience with document/discovery databases (., Relativity).
  • 3-7 years of experience in complex commercial litigation.
  • Graduate of an accredited law school.
  • Admitted to practice law in the State of Michigan or have the ability to obtain admission.
